ios - 使用自动布局在 View 中居中 UI 元素

标签 ios interface-builder autolayout

在横向和纵向模式下,如何使用自动布局使 UI 元素从左到右居中?自动布局中可以有变量吗?

最佳答案

如果您使用界面构建器来创建和设置 View 的位置,请选择您的 View 并按照下面的屏幕截图建议进行操作。

enter image description here

之后,单击“添加约束”,您就完成了。这只是为了将您的 View 设置在水平中心。但是您仍然必须添加更多约束。它们是:

  1. 高度
  2. 宽度
  3. 与顶部/底部布局指南/ View 的距离。

如果您不知道该怎么做,请告诉我。

关于ios - 使用自动布局在 View 中居中 UI 元素,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21793542/

相关文章:

ios:在xib中加载自定义 View

ios - 自动布局 Xcode。 iPhone 模拟器与 Xcode 预览不匹配

ios - 为什么当我将 UILabel 移动到某个点时,它会在我进入全屏模式时移动?

objective-c - IOS objective-C 实例变量——有什么区别

ios - 如何更改 iOS 7 上 UINavigationBar 中文本的颜色?

interface-builder - 在 Cappuccino 中添加多个Cib/Xib文件

ios - 使用自动布局将表格 View 单元格高度调整为图像的高度

iphone - 具有多个 UILabel 和图像的自定义按钮

ios - Swift iOS : Parsing of date from a string does not work for some devices. 太奇怪了

macos - 在 IB 中的两个 nsbutton 之间设置响应者链